In this episode of The History AI Podcast, Chuck and Marco unravel the dramatic story of the Hartford Convention of 1814—a secretive gathering that started as a protest against the War of 1812 and ended with the downfall of the Federalist Party. Discover who was involved, what they debated, why secession was on the table, and how a catastrophic case of bad timing sealed the party's fate.

From political power plays to PR disasters, this episode dives into one of early America’s most misunderstood moments.
